*23 Sivan – A Day of Special Opportunity and Blessing*

In 1983, during a farbrengen on Parshas Shlach, the Rebbe spoke about the significance of the 23rd of Sivan.

The Rebbe explained that in Megillas Esther, after Haman was hanged, it was on the 23rd of Sivan that “the king’s scribes were summoned.” On that day, Mordechai instructed them to write the royal decree that empowered the Jewish people to defend themselves and defeat their enemies 💪, effectively overturning the decree of destruction. This became the foundation for the salvation and joy of Purim.

**The Rebbe emphasized that every event in the Torah is eternal and reawakens each year**

Just as the king’s scribes were called upon then to write a decree of salvation, so too every 23 Sivan, the “scribes of the King” are called upon once again. Our sages explain that Achashverosh alludes to the King of all kings, Hashem.

The Rebbe added that every Jew possesses the strength of Mordechai, a Jew who refuses to bow to anything opposed to Torah and holiness ✨

Therefore, today the 23 Sivan is a day of special spiritual power, when every Jew can turn to Hashem with their requests and prayers and writing our own “good decrees” for ourselves, our families, and the entire Jewish people. Above all, it is a day to pray for Geulah, speedily in our days.

In this week’s Parsha, Shelach, Moshe sends twelve spies to scout the Land of Israel. Ten return with fear and doubt, while Calev and Yehoshua, seeing the presence of Hashem, declare: “עלה נעלה We shall surely go up!”

For many of us who have made aliyah, served as lone soldiers, and are building a life here in Israel, their message feels deeply personal. There are moments when the challenges seem bigger than we are. Yet Calev and Yehoshua remind us that while the challenges are real, so is the opportunity, and that Hashem believes in us even when we doubt ourselves.
